prove necessary

Frequency: 7.010.2 per million words

To be shown to be necessary over time.

Examples (10)

  • The new regulations may prove necessary for environmental protection.
  • If the current measures don't work, further action will prove necessary.
  • It didn't prove necessary to call an ambulance after all.
  • Additional funds might prove necessary to complete the project on time.
  • In the long run, these difficult changes will prove necessary for the company's survival.
  • The emergency exit could prove necessary in case of fire.
  • We hoped that the intervention would not prove necessary.
  • His expertise might prove necessary for solving this complex problem.
  • To our surprise, the extra preparations did not prove necessary.
  • Sometimes, tough decisions prove necessary for progress.
